Diamond appears in Series 5, released under Cardsmiths Currency, a premium collector line tracing the history of money from ancient coinage to cryptocurrency. Jon McTavish illustrated it. It is card 57 of 167 in the set. The variant tree for this card runs to 25 entries, the scarcest being Onyx, numbered to 1.

Diamonds are precious gemstones renowned for their brilliance and hardness, making them highly sought after in jewelry and industrial applications. The value of a diamond is determined by the 4Cs: carat weight, cut, color, and clarity. In 2023, the total value of diamonds exported globally was approximately $98.9 billion. The largest diamond ever discovered is the Cullinan Diamond, weighing 3,106 carats.
